Summary:
The Sr. HR Generalist develops and implements effective Human Resource policies, programs and processes in support of production operations and team members needs. Provides services in recruiting/selection, team member complaint investigation/response, performance management, pay administration actions/transfers, job description development and career pathing. Works with management to develop and implement positive culture building programs, employee appreciation/recognition, wellness & safety, workers compensation/return to work actions and proactive member communications. Provides guidance to production management on Human Resource policy, Federal, State and local laws and regulations and corrective actions. Helps to create and implement training for team leader and member development.
